Police in Chesapeake have identified human remains found near a car dealership Thursday afternoon.

On July 12, police said the body belonged to 35-year-old Eric "Harris" Crump, who was reported missing by his family on July 3.



Leo Kosinski, a department spokesman, said foul play is not suspected. Police are investigating the death as a suicide.
